About Fishing at Lac d'Issarlès

Lac d'Issarlès is a pristine mountain trout lake in central France (436 miles from Calais) where pike and perch offer exciting alternatives to the trout-focused regulations—this 1st category water prohibits night fishing, so it's a daytime-only destination suited to anglers seeking cooler-water species in stunning Auvergne scenery. Bank fishing only, so you'll need to work the margins and shallows rather than accessing deeper zones, making it better suited to pike hunters than carp specialists. You'll need a valid French fishing licence and must register with the local AAPPMA (Fédération de Pêche de Haute-Loire); contact them in advance to confirm pike and perch seasons.

Fishing Rules & Regulations — Lac d'Issarlès

Night fishing at Lac d'Issarlès is not permitted. Night carp is generally not authorised in Haute-Loire. The department is dominated by salmonid and volcanic mountain waters. Verify with peche-hauteloire.fr for any specific 2nd category exceptions. Anglers must leave the bank before dark.

Boat fishing: Boats are permitted at Lac d'Issarlès.

Bivouac & overnight camping is permitted at Lac d'Issarlès under standard French fishing law — one rod, within 10m of the water, no open fires.

Managed by FD 43 (Fédération de Pêche de Haute-Loire). Always verify current rules with the AAPPMA before your session — regulations can change seasonally.

Fish Species at Lac d'Issarlès

Lac d'Issarlès holds brown trout, rainbow trout, perch, pike. Pike fishing is a highlight of the venue — spinning, deadbaiting and lure fishing are all effective methods.

A valid Carte de Pêche is required to fish Lac d'Issarlès — you will also need to be affiliated with FD 43 (Fédération de Pêche de Haute-Loire). Licences are available online before your trip.

Fishing Season & Rules

1st Category (Salmonid) water. Trout season: 14 Mar–20 Sep 2026. No night fishing permitted. Carp/coarse: all year.

Always verify current rules with the local AAPPMA (FD 43 (Fédération de Pêche de Haute-Loire)) before fishing. French fishing regulations can change seasonally.

Planning a Trip to Lac d'Issarlès

To fish Lac d'Issarlès, you need a valid Carte de Pêche (French fishing licence), available online at cartedepeche.fr before you leave the UK — affiliation with FD 43 (Fédération de Pêche de Haute-Loire) is included in the purchase process. Annual, weekly and daily licences are all available online.
